The radio spot was only about ten seconds long. Mainly mention that "concealed carry" legislation had been introduced, that residents would no longer need to unload and case firearms before entering their vehicle, and a general comment the legislation contained fewer licensing or oversight than past bills.

The above is not an exact quote but any WPR listeners out there can post any details I've missed or don't have quite correct.
